Safety sensors are required on all modern garage doors to prevent the door from closing on people, pets, or objects. If your door hits the floor and immediately reverses, or if it won't move at all, the sensors are the first thing to check. We test the signal integrity and ensure the mounting hardware is secure so your door operates safely. If they have failed due to age or water damage, we provide replacements. What is involved in repairing garage door sensors in Memphis?

Repairing garage door sensors in Memphis involves diagnosing why the opener isn't responding to the safety beams. This often includes checking for obstructions, ensuring the sensors are clean, and verifying they are properly aligned. If the sensors are damaged or faulty, they may need to be replaced entirely. Licensed pros will ensure the new sensors are correctly wired and calibrated for optimal safety.

What are the main differences between chain and belt drive garage door openers?

Chain drive garage door openers in Memphis utilize a metal chain to move the trolley along the rail, offering a robust and often more economical solution. Belt drive openers, on the other hand, use a rubber belt, which results in quieter operation and is generally preferred for attached garages. Both systems are reliable, but the choice often comes down to noise preference and budget considerations.

When is garage door spring replacement necessary?

Garage door spring replacement becomes necessary when springs show signs of wear, such as rust, breakage, or a loss of tension, making the door difficult or impossible to lift manually. A sudden 'snap' sound often indicates a broken spring. This is a critical safety repair, as springs are under immense tension, and professional replacement is essential to prevent injury.

What are the benefits of a side mount garage door opener?

Side mount garage door openers, also known as jackshaft openers, are ideal for garages with low headroom or unique ceiling configurations in Memphis. They mount directly to the torsion spring shaft on the side of the door, freeing up ceiling space. These openers often provide quiet operation and can be equipped with advanced features like integrated battery backup and Wi-Fi connectivity.

What is included in general garage door repair services?

General garage door repair services encompass a wide range of tasks, from fixing bent tracks and replacing worn rollers to adjusting cables and lubricating moving parts. It also includes diagnosing and repairing issues with the opener system, such as sensor problems or motor malfunctions. The goal is to restore the door's safe, smooth, and reliable operation, ensuring all components function correctly.
